My llama.cpp recipe 👉
🧠 Qwen3.5-4B Q4_K_M GGUF
⚙️ Ryzen 5 7540U — 6C/12T
🧵 --threads 9
🧵 --threads-batch 12
⚡ --prio 2
🔄 --poll 50
📦 --batch-size 2048
📦 --ubatch-size 512
🚀 --flash-attn on
🧠 KV cache: q4_0 / q4_0
🔧 --repack
💾 --mmap
👤 --parallel 1
🚫 --device none
🚫 --gpu-layers 0
🚫 KV/op GPU offload
🚫 MTP OFF
Interesting result 👉 MTP=3 was slower (~10 tps in benchmarks).
Plain decode + 9 threads + Q4 KV hit ~11.4 tok/s.
That's about 10% faster just from tuning llama.cpp — on a basic laptop CPU.
